What type of education and learning and previous experience does the possible kid care supplier have? The majority of experts consider caretaker education and training to be among the most critical locations for guaranteeing and enhancing the top quality of day care.


The amount of children will each caretaker deal with and the number of children will be in the team? Less youngsters per caregiver and smaller sized team dimensions are necessary because youngsters receive more private interest and caregivers can be much more receptive to every youngster's requirements. The kid care licensing and certification policies define the maximum variety of kids who may be looked after in a group and they likewise specify the number of caretakers required for a group of youngsters.


When children are between ages 3 and 4 years, the Group Childcare Center licensing policies enable 10 children per caregiver without any even more than 20 kids in a team. There should be some framework in the everyday tasks prepared for kids with chances to play outside every day. The program must be outfitted with playthings and furnishings that are safe and youngster suitable. There should be open rooms for youngsters to explore and silent areas for checking out a publication or playing with challenges.


Sometimes, when you are asking to tour a program prior to placing your kid there for treatment, a program may ask that you make a consultation so that a person might be totally free to reveal you around and respond to concerns. But as soon as your kid is registered in the program, you deserve to come in to the facility any time.




Things to seek when seeing a program include noise degrees; sobbing youngsters; whether there are tvs transformed on at all times; and whether kids appear involved in purposeful play activities or are straying aimlessly - child care near me. All certified and licensed programs obtain regular monitoring brows through. Each time a checking browse through is carried out, the licensing/certification specialist checks to guarantee conformity with chosen licensing/certification regulations.


These records recognizing the outcomes of keeping an eye on brows through for both qualified and public institution ran day care programs are shown on the public childcare search internet site. In certified programs, the reports visit additionally should be posted near the certificate in a location that is easily visible to moms and dads and the general public.

Moms and dads are encouraged to call or visit the local licensing office or accreditation company to discover even more concerning a program's conformity history. The licensing/certification workplace will additionally be able to tell you if any issues have actually been filed concerning the program and whether those complaints were confirmed.
